Early biofouling colonization stages: Implications for operation and maintenance planning in Marine Renewable Energy projects

  • 1. WavEC Offshore Renewables

Description

This file contains data pertaining to the paper entitled "Early biofouling colonization stages: Implications for operation and maintenance planning in Marine Renewable Energy projects". It includes the friction forces generated from scraping each of the biofouling samples and the friction forces from subsequential scraping of certain samples.
